Course Curriculum
-
1
Free Preview
-
2
Chapter 1: The Foundation of Visual Thinking
-
(Included in full purchase)
The Foundation of Visual Thinking
-
(Included in full purchase)
The Foundation of Visual Thinking
-
(Included in full purchase)
-
3
Chapter 2: Setting Up Your Visualization Environment
-
(Included in full purchase)
Setting Up Your Visualization Environment
-
(Included in full purchase)
Setting Up Your Visualization Environment
-
(Included in full purchase)
-
4
Chapter 3: Data Handling Essentials
-
(Included in full purchase)
Data Handling Essentials
-
(Included in full purchase)
Data Handling Essentials
-
(Included in full purchase)
-
5
Chapter 4: Matplotlib Fundamentals
-
(Included in full purchase)
Matplotlib Fundamentals
-
(Included in full purchase)
Matplotlib Fundamentals
-
(Included in full purchase)
-
6
Chapter 5: Customizing Matplotlib Aesthetics
-
(Included in full purchase)
Customizing Matplotlib Aesthetics
-
(Included in full purchase)
Customizing Matplotlib Aesthetics
-
(Included in full purchase)
-
7
Chapter 6: Arranging Matplotlib Plots
-
(Included in full purchase)
Arranging Matplotlib Plots
-
(Included in full purchase)
Arranging Matplotlib Plots
-
(Included in full purchase)
-
8
Chapter 7: Advanced Matplotlib Techniques
-
(Included in full purchase)
Advanced Matplotlib Techniques
-
(Included in full purchase)
Advanced Matplotlib Techniques
-
(Included in full purchase)
-
9
Chapter 8: Preparing Matplotlib for Production
-
(Included in full purchase)
Preparing Matplotlib for Production
-
(Included in full purchase)
Preparing Matplotlib for Production
-
(Included in full purchase)
-
10
Chapter 9: Introduction to Seaborn
-
(Included in full purchase)
Introduction to Seaborn
-
(Included in full purchase)
Introduction to Seaborn
-
(Included in full purchase)
-
11
Chapter 10: Seaborn for Distribution and Categorical Data
-
(Included in full purchase)
Seaborn for Distribution and Categorical Data
-
(Included in full purchase)
Seaborn for Distribution and Categorical Data
-
(Included in full purchase)
-
12
Chapter 11: Seaborn for Relationships and Matrix Plots
-
(Included in full purchase)
Seaborn for Relationships and Matrix Plots
-
(Included in full purchase)
Seaborn for Relationships and Matrix Plots
-
(Included in full purchase)
-
13
Chapter 12: Advanced Seaborn Features
-
(Included in full purchase)
Advanced Seaborn Features
-
(Included in full purchase)
Advanced Seaborn Features
-
(Included in full purchase)
-
14
Chapter 13: Prompting for Visualization Code
-
(Included in full purchase)
Prompting for Visualization Code
-
(Included in full purchase)
Prompting for Visualization Code
-
(Included in full purchase)
-
15
Chapter 14: Refining AI-Generated Visualizations
-
(Included in full purchase)
Refining AI-Generated Visualizations
-
(Included in full purchase)
Refining AI-Generated Visualizations
-
(Included in full purchase)
-
16
Chapter 15: Automation with AI Prompts
-
(Included in full purchase)
Automation with AI Prompts
-
(Included in full purchase)
Automation with AI Prompts
-
(Included in full purchase)
-
17
Chapter 16: Building Reusable Prompt Templates
-
(Included in full purchase)
Building Reusable Prompt Templates
-
(Included in full purchase)
Building Reusable Prompt Templates
-
(Included in full purchase)
-
18
Chapter 17: Data Storytelling and Ethics
-
(Included in full purchase)
Data Storytelling and Ethics
-
(Included in full purchase)
Data Storytelling and Ethics
-
(Included in full purchase)
-
19
Chapter 18: The Future of Visualization AI
-
(Included in full purchase)
The Future of Visualization AI
-
(Included in full purchase)
The Future of Visualization AI
-
(Included in full purchase)
-
20
Index
-
(Included in full purchase)
Index
-
(Included in full purchase)
About the Course
Data visualization turns complex data into insight, alignment, and action—and it is a core skill for modern data, analytics, and engineering roles. Prompting Python Data Visualization shows you how to design clear, trustworthy visuals in Python, while accelerating the entire workflow by translating natural-language intent into working visualization code with AI. You begin with the foundations of visual thinking and data handling, then build strong technical skills using Matplotlib and Seaborn. The book takes you from basic plots to advanced layouts, styling, annotations, time-series analysis, and publication-ready exports, grounded in real-world analytics and reporting use cases. As you progress, you learn prompt engineering techniques to generate charts with AI, refine and debug AI-produced code, and automate repetitive visualization tasks using reusable prompt templates. By the end of the book, you will produce professional visuals for reports, notebooks, and dashboards with speed, consistency, and confidence.
About the Author
Aleksei Aleinikov is a Senior Platform and Cloud Engineer specializing in security-first cloud architecture and scalable systems. He builds reliable Python analytics and visualization workflows, focusing on IAM, observability, and operational rigor, and actively shares hands-on engineering insights with the developer community.